When selecting a sectional one, you must first measure the space where you're planning to place the sofa. Utilize a tape measure to get accurate measurements and note any passageways or doors that the sofa may need to fit through upon delivery. Mark the area you want to place the sofa using masking tape or painter's tap. This will give you an idea of how much space the sectional will occupy and lets you avoid purchasing a piece that is too big for the room.

You'll also need to know the length, which is usually the longest part of the sofa. Also, you'll need to know the length, which is typically the longest side of the sofa. If you are buying an L-shaped sectional, the width is the distance between the back of the sofa and the left or right-hand side of your chaise lounge. The length is the distance between the back of the sofa and the front edge of the piece that protrudes most forward.

Shape

A sectional sofa is a modular furniture piece that can be disassembled into sections and reassembled in various ways to fit the space. It is the ideal option to maximize the space in your living room or family room, and is usually more comfortable than a traditional sofa. When you are choosing the best sectional, there are a few things to take into consideration.

The most important thing to do is take measurements of your space to ensure that the sectional will fit. Start by taking measurements of the length and depth of your space. The width is measured from one side of a sofa to the other. The depth is the height that is measured from the couch's floor. Once you have these measurements, you can start exploring different sectional sofas to find the ideal one for your space.

When choosing a sectional style, the design is crucial. You want to make sure the style is timeless so that it can be an appropriate fit for your home for years to be. There are a variety of options available in a range of colors, from classic ones like gray and black to more contemporary designs. There are also sectional couches that come with features like a central storage console, which is ideal for holding remotes, magazines and other items you don't want on the couch.

When shopping for a sectional you should take into consideration the size of other furniture pieces, like TV stands and coffee tables. Also, you should take into consideration whether you have any entryways that are blocked by the sectional. It's not necessary to purchase an item that blocks your front door.

There are a variety of sectional sofas available. These include L-shaped and U shapes. They are great for smaller spaces as they can be positioned in the corner of your room. You can also pick sectional couches with curved edges which look amazing when paired with round coffee tables. They are perfect for larger rooms.

Mark the area you'd like to place your sectional by using masking tape or painter's tap. You can then use this as a reference point to determine what size of sectional will work best in your space. Ideally, you want to avoid "pinch points" in which the clearance between the sofa and furniture is less than 36 inches.

Once you've decided which place to put the sofa, use a tape measure to measure it. You'll want to know the measurements of the sofa from the end to the end, as well from the back to the chaise or another seat. It's crucial to know the depth, especially if you're planning on including an in-center storage console.

The number of pieces in sections can affect the price. Some sectionals are modular, so you can easily add or remove pieces to fit your space. Some options are more unified like the set that comes with a traditional sofa, loveseat and chair. You can go beyond the basic design by adding a power-reclining option or a set that comes with chaise lounge and a chair.

Customization

You can customize your sectional in many ways. You could choose a fabric that complements other furniture pieces in your living room for a cohesive look, or you might opt for a mix of colors to create an eclectic vibe. Certain brands offer tools to allow online customization, so you can test various combinations before purchasing. Some brands, such as Cozey allow you to see a 3D image of your sofa in the room you've selected.

A lot of modern sectionals are upholstered in performance fabrics that are resistant to stains, hair and water. This kind of upholstery is typically more expensive than traditional fabrics but it's worth the cost for families with children and pets. The performance fabrics are available from many of the best sectional manufacturers, including West Elm, Apt2B and Room & Board.

The Isobel modular sofa from Urban Outfitters, for example is a chic and comfortable option. It's upholstered in linen and white and comes with three pieces that can be put together to create an L-shaped shape or split into any letter you like. It's not cheap, but the superior linen upholstery and modular design make it an attractive choice for a casual living room.

Other options that can be customized include adjustable chaise extensions that can be reversed, movable ottomans and adjustable headrests. Certain of these features might not be crucial to many consumers, but they could make a sectional more accommodating to your lifestyle. For instance, reversible reclining chaise extensions let you choose which side to recline on depending on the direction of traffic in your space as well as movable ottomans that can serve as an extra seat for parties or when guests arrive.
